Transaction 63cd96f1fe4d35e6884604366215fa49ee77cfed539073da6645e91feec765bc
1 Input
1 Output
-
63cd96f1fe4d35e6884604366215fa49ee77cfed539073da6645e91feec765bc:0
- value
- 4738275
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 384bc72992c6af58665fa55f0ae6aaa0b895a8ba OP_EQUALVERIFY OP_CHECKSIG
- address
- 168fctYgFMuHgvQNHCeTxd6ERcWuyGzJU4